Exploring the depiction of fathers in Hollywood, this book examines how these portrayals shape American societal norms and cultural myths, particularly the American Dream. It argues that the representation of paternal figures is essential in constructing and reflecting the values and dynamics of family life within the broader context of American society. Through analysis, it highlights the significant influence of film on perceptions of fatherhood and its implications for cultural identity.
